    Commentary: Trump’s tariffs are likely to outlast him

    TRADE POLICY REDEFINED

    The president has redefined regular commerce coverage. Speak of TACO (Trump All the time Chickens Out) is deceptive. True, the administration has veered backwards and forwards on tariffs, sooner or later threatening terribly excessive obstacles, the following, after financial-market blowback, decreasing or pausing them whereas it negotiates.

    Sure, by the requirements of his most audacious threats, in the present day’s common efficient tariff of roughly 15 per cent appears to be like timid. However measured towards pre-Trump, it’s nonetheless transformative, and so is the pondering that underpins it.

    The presumption in favour of low or zero tariffs is gone. So is the concept that commerce is positive-sum, and {that a} multilateral rule-based system is one of the best ways to grasp the beneficial properties.

    When the administration final week doubled US tariffs on metal and aluminium from 25 per cent to 50 per cent, the response wasn’t, “What on earth are they pondering?” It was, “Properly, that doesn’t a lot change the general common.”

    All by itself, the so-called “baseline (that’s, common) reciprocal” tariff of 10 per cent renounces the post-war buying and selling order – and it’s already seen as no large deal.

    This new Washington Consensus isn’t the one issue. Many companies are pushing again towards the brand new tariffs, arguing that the obstacles will enhance prices, disrupt provide chains and switch earlier investments into losses. However as soon as they’ve tailored to the brand new regime, the identical calculations will push the opposite manner: Please don’t change the foundations once more.

    As well as, home producers going through much less competitors from overseas will be capable to elevate their costs. As soon as they begin amassing the rents created by commerce obstacles, they’ll favour retaining them, or perhaps elevating them additional.
